""The Yearbook Commercial Arbitration"" has established its reputation as a leading publication in the field of international commercial arbitration. The publication reflects ICCA's goal to promote arbitration as a flexible mechanism of dispute settlement in the increasingly litiginous world of global trade. By sharing the most up-to-date information on arbitral awards, court decisions, arbitration rules and legislation, the yearbook offers legal practitioners and scholars comprehensive documentation and commentary on international commercial arbitration.
This volume distinguishes itself from previous volumes in its additional coverage of arbitral decisions on domain name disputes from the World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O) Arbitration and Mediation Center and excerpts of 62 court decisions originating from 10 countries applying and interpreting the 1958 New York Convention.
